Hazelwood School District Sealed Solicitation
Title: Transportation Supplies (Oil and Fluids) Bid - 2024-2025
Deadline: 7/30/2024 10:30 AM (UTC-06:00) Central Time (US & Canada)
Status: Deadline Expired
Description: The district is seeking bids for various Transportation Oil and Fluids supplies.

Question 1
Posted: 7/18/2024
Question: 1. Should the first description say 15w-40 instead of W40? 2. For the antifreeze, are you looking for 50/50 or concentrate? 3. On the ww fluid, would a -20 degree product work? The description says -25, so I just wanted to make sure. 4. It seems like the only form that a lubricant vendor would fill out is Page 3. We don’t typically fill out project/subcontractor forms. Which forms would you like filled out and submitted back to you?
Response: 1.Yes 15w40 2. Antifreeze either way 3. Washer fluid -20 is fine 4. correct 5. The specification form with the your quoted prices, bid proposal form, and everify form.
Question 2
Posted: 7/23/2024
Question: Is the CK4 W40 HD Oil supposed to be a straight 40W? Normally we see this as a multi viscosity of 15W40. Are the anti-freeze drums a 50/50 blend or concentrate?
Response: 15/40 Anti freeze can be either way as long as you specify which one.
Question 3
Posted: 7/24/2024
Question: Does the full synthetic need to meet dexos1 spec?
Response: No it does not.
Question 4
Posted: 7/24/2024
Question: Should I just skip the forms for the subcontractors and/or any forms that don't apply to a lube bid? Which forms do you need filled out?
Response: Subcontractor forms are not needed. The specification form with the your quoted prices, bid proposal form, and everify form.
